Output 76a145aba35b2a0ae4778c8bb7d1a92b96713b12a29945ef767e51d116952910:0

value
739672
script pubkey
OP_0 OP_PUSHBYTES_20 d6850f014fcd4ac53c9a736aba5033e3c6ef5d6b
address
tb1q66zs7q20e49v20y6wd4t55pnu0rw7httevmpg7
transaction
76a145aba35b2a0ae4778c8bb7d1a92b96713b12a29945ef767e51d116952910
confirmations
79897
spent
true